Area description

Graduates who have taken this area of specialisation possess all the knowledge and skills required of computer scientists. Moreover, they have specialised in computer architectures, the technologies required to design them and architecture-aware software.

Professionals who have specialised in this area have the skills needed to design computers and develop applications in keeping with the computer architecture on which they will be executed, taking full advantage of the resources available and attaining high performance. They are proficient in the assessment of computers, concurrent programming, operating system tools, internal structure and code generation and optimisation. They are well acquainted with multiprocessing systems, supercomputers and other advanced architectures. They are able to make the most of the features of systems with specialised architectures and tools for designing microprocessors and other integrated circuits.
